- [ ] **Step 7: Breaker override escrow.** After sealing the signing keys for the Tallgrove upstream API circuit breaker, confirm the support team can force the breaker open during a full outage. The override bundle lives in the sealed escrow drawer and is useless without its unlock phrase. Two ceremony witnesses must initial this step before proceeding. The escrow bundle is decrypted with the recovery passphrase that follows.

vault phrase of kahip-kahop = holath-quenmir

## Who to ping about GiftNote

Welcome aboard! GiftNote is our donation-receipt mailer for the Larchfield Fund. Template tweaks go to the comms folks; delivery failures and bounce weirdness go to the platform crew. Don't push template changes on Fridays — receipts batch over the weekend. For anything GiftNote-related, start with the address below.

billing contact of kaweg-tajeg = drudor.lamion.oliath@torvalabs.test

## Changelog — Font vendoring defaults changed

As of this release, the Bracken UI build no longer fetches third-party fonts at build time. All typefaces used by the Lanternwell suite are now vendored into the repo under a dedicated assets directory, and the fetch step is skipped by default. If you're onboarding, nothing to install — the fonts travel with the checkout. The build flags controlling this behavior are listed below.

settings of hadup-yafog:
LAMAEL_PIN=3761
LAMAEL_TENANT=istmir
LAMAEL_METRICS_HOST=metrics.lamael.plorvasys.test
LAMAEL_SEAL=seal_8ea68500
LAMAEL_STANDBY_TEAM=fraok

**Q: Can customers change when their batch email digests go out?**

Yep! Digest scheduling in Mailwren lives under Notification Preferences, and customers can pick hourly, daily, or weekly batches. The quirk to know: changes take effect at the *next* send window, not immediately, so a customer switching from weekly to daily might wait up to 24 hours. If they claim digests stopped entirely, check whether their timezone got reset during the Parrow migration. Full troubleshooting steps are on the internal wiki page below.

runbook for baguf-bawip: https://jira.qorvelsys.internal/pages/pages/pages/browse/1853